Exomilus dyscritos is a tiny type of sea snail. It's a marine mollusk that belongs to a group called gastropods. This small creature is part of the family called Raphitomidae.

About This Snail

This sea snail has a shell that is quite small. It usually grows up to about 9.1 millimeters long. That's less than half an inch! The shell is also quite narrow, measuring about 2.7 millimeters across.

The shell of Exomilus dyscritos is generally solid and white. It has a long and narrow shape. Sometimes, you might see a brownish tint on some of its raised parts. The shell has about seven spirals, which are called whorls.

Where It Lives

This special sea snail lives in the ocean waters around Australia. It is found only in this region, which means it is an endemic species. You can find Exomilus dyscritos off the coasts of South Australia and Tasmania.
